Article: School Budget Reaches 'Ceiling' in Waldwick, N.J.

By Brian Aberback, The Record, Hackensack, N.J. Knight Ridder/Tribune Business News

Apr. 25--WALDWICK, N.J. -- Borough and school officials cited tough economic times, low voter turnout, and a controversial decision to install artificial turf on the junior-senior high school football field as possible reasons the school budget was defeated last week for the second time in three years.

"I don't think that people feel that the schools are being run poorly," said Mayor Rick Vander Wende. "I think it's very much the idea that some sort of glass ceiling was hit as to what people can take in terms of being taxed."
